Summary
This study looks at how eating a high-fat meal affects a part of the brain called the hypothalamus, which controls hunger and metabolism. Researchers will use MRI scans and blood tests in 20 healthy men to see if the brain's immune cells become active after a fatty meal. The goal is to better understand the link between diet and brain function, which could help in fighting obesity.

- What this could lead to
- If successful, this could reveal how the brain's immune cells respond to fatty foods, potentially pointing to new ways to manage obesity and overeating.
- What could go wrong
- This is a very early, small study in only 20 healthy men, so results may not apply to women or people with health conditions. It is observational and does not test a treatment.
